Established in 1972, Radical Philosophy (RP) is one of the UK's oldest self-published journals of the independent left. This Winter 2021 issue contains an essay by Étienne Balibar on human species as a biopolitical concept; reflection on the racial cadences of fire by Ahmed Diaa Dardir; a translation of an essay by Michele Spanò on Michel Foucault 's 1971-1973 Collège de France lectures on ( Penal Theories and Institutions and The Punitive Society ); a critique of Bernard Stiegler's contributive economy by Solange Manche; newly translated pieces by Alexandre Kojève on Europe and the USSR; an obituary to Jean-Luc Nancy (1940-2021) by Joanna Hodge ; and a number of reviews.
